I've lived in the Legends for 2 years, and I will be leaving soon. I'm fairly certain the HoA is out of cash. They recently decided to charge renters (NOT owners) $20/year for parking passes to "hire a private security firm", to deal with parking issues on the 115 side. Quite frankly, I have yet to see any security, and can't figure out why they would want to do that in the first place. Only the one side has parking restrictions, why not just make assigned parking? So, renters are beginning to pay for the services that the HoA is responsible to provide. Of course it goes without saying that renters (while funding the HoA) will receive no membership rights, nor will they receive any votes on future fees or taxes that will inevitably levied upon them. I tried to get my a parking pass today, and was going to ask for information regarding the HoA board members and their addresses, the alleged security firm that I'm now funding, and the HoA's financial situation (any member would have access to this info, and since I'm now funding their operations, I'd assume I'd have that same right)... but alas, the property management company High Tide Associates was not open during their regular hours of operation! I gave them 10 minutes until after they were supposed to open, but had to run to work. Anyway, long story short, don't rent from this place. It's apparent that the regime is about out of money. I saw 6 foreclosures/short-sales listed online today, so I'd imagine their monies are pretty bad off. What services are they going to cut back on to help their money shortage? HoA's are responsible for the roofs of these condos... suppose you're renting and your building needs a new roof, and the regime doesn't have the funds to fix it... you're screwed. As far as the last 2 years go, this place wasn't terrible. The property was usually fairly clean. The rules of the pool are not followed, and children will be screaming up until midnight during the summers. There are some 20-something neighbors who can be loud and drunk in the parking lots fairly late at night, but I never felt as though they were a "danger"... that's about it.
